  • Domestic production of renewable fuels adds value to our agricultural products and stimulates economic growth and employment in our rural communities. In the US the production of ethanol has gone from 100 million litres a year in 1980 to 12 billion litres of ethanol a year, this has meant 4% income added to US Farmers, at least 300,000 jobs, US$2 billion reduction in the US trade deficit.
  • In Australia the domestic production of renewable fuels would reduce our reliance on depleting domestic and foreign oil reserves. By providing an alternative fuel resource ethanol plays a crucial role in ensuring Australians energy security.
